Why Choose a Payroll Clerk Course?
Payroll clerks are essential roles in many organizations, responsible for calculating employee wages, handling tax and benefits issues, and ensuring compliance with labor regulations. As the demand for accuracy and compliance in businesses increases, payroll clerk jobs are also on the rise, particularly in Canada.
🔹 High Earning Potential
According to labor market data in Canada, the average annual salary for a payroll clerk is between $45,000 and $60,000, depending on experience, industry, and region.
🔹 Stable Employment Outlook
Payroll clerks are needed in various sectors, especially accounting firms, government agencies, and large corporations. With the advancement of technology, the use of payroll management software is becoming more common, making payroll clerk positions even more necessary and efficient.
🔹 Flexible Career Development Paths
Once you become a payroll clerk, you can further enhance your skills by obtaining other financial certifications, and you can even advance to positions like payroll manager or human resources director.
